wubantu安装xxl-job
时间: 2023-11-07 08:57:04 浏览: 165
安装xxl-job的步骤如下:
1. 进入xxl-job的源项目。
2. 选择1.9.1的tag并下载。
3. 运行mvn clean deploy命令将项目安装到仓库中,确保安装了xxl-job-core子模块。
4. 下载本项目并打开resources/application-dev.yml文件。
5. 将配置改为自己的配置,参考xx中的内容。
6. 引入xxl-job-core作为jar依赖。
相关问题
docker安装xxl-job-admin
Docker安装Xxl-Job Admin(阿里云开源的分布式任务调度系统)可以通过以下步骤完成:
1. **前提准备**:
- 确保已经安装了Docker Desktop(如果你使用的是Windows或Mac)或Docker CLI(Linux环境)。
- 可能需要在命令行中使用`sudo`权限,特别是对于Linux用户。
2. **添加官方镜像仓库**:
```
docker pull registry.aliyuncs.com/xxljob/admin-server
```
3. **运行容器**:
使用下面的命令启动Xxl-Admin服务:
```bash
docker run -p 8080:8080 -d --name xxladmin registry.aliyuncs.com/xxljob/admin-server
```
`-p`选项将主机的8080端口映射到容器内的8080端口,`-d`表示后台运行,`--name`用于给容器命名以便于管理。
4. **验证安装**:
打开浏览器访问`http://localhost:8080`,如果看到Xxl-Job的登录界面,说明安装和配置成功。
5. **额外配置**:
- 如果有自定义配置文件,可以将它们挂载到容器的相应路径,例如:
```bash
docker run -p 8080:8080 -v /path/to/config:/usr/local/xxl-job-admin/conf -d --name xxladmin registry.aliyuncs.com/xxljob/admin-server
```
- 查看官方文档(https://www.xxl.job/zh/docs/installation/docker)获取更详细的配置指导。
本地安装xxl-job
要在本地安装xxl-job,需要进行以下几个步骤:
1. 首先,你需要在本地项目中引入xxl-job的相关依赖,包括xxl-job-core和xxl-job-executor-samples。xxl-job-core存放了xxl-job中的执行器,而xxl-job-executor-samples中则存放了一些示例代码用于参考部署。
2. 在你的本地项目中创建一个测试案例类,并使用@XxlJob注解来标记定时任务的方法。在这个方法中,你可以编写你要执行的任务代码。你还可以通过XxlJobHelper来获取一些任务的相关信息,例如参数、机器数量等。
3. 配置将你的测试案例发布到xxl-job的调度中心。这可以通过在配置文件中指定调度中心的地址和端口来实现。
总的来说,你需要在你的本地项目中引入xxl-job的依赖,编写测试案例类来定义你的定时任务,然后配置将这个测试案例发布到xxl-job的调度中心。这样就可以在本地安装xxl-job并使用它来进行定时任务的管理和执行了。<span class="em">1</span><span class="em">2</span><span class="em">3</span><span class="em">4</span>
阅读全文